Summary/Abstract: The aim of the article is to present two previously unknown drawings by Norwid, inspired by the New Testament, which have recently been added to the register of his artistic legacy. The first of the sketches Chrystus i dzieci w świątyni jerozolimskiej [Christ and Children in the Temple of Jerusalem] (1855, lost) illustrates a quotation from the Gospel of Matthew (Mt 21, 15-17). The second composition Chrystus błogosławiący dzieci [Christ Blessing Children] (1857, National Library) refers to an episode mentioned several times in the Gospels (Mt 19, 13-15; Mk 10, 13-16; Lk 18,15-17).
